Requirements & Guidelines

You may use any blocks you would like, the ones above and other ones you have discovered.

  • Combine animation, sound, interactive clicking, etc to make a cool video!
  • It must reset itself when clicking the green flag
  • Must be at least 30 second long
  • Must have at least 3 backgrounds (use broadcast)
  • Must have at least 3 sprites each with 3 costumes
  • Must have one part where a sprite "sings" along with "say" blocks timed correctly
  • Cannot crash; cannot stop in the middle; cannot have sprites error (disappear unexpectedly or "freak out" turning)
  • Check out the Resources page for free to use sounds.
  • Must be school appropriate, and not infringe on copyright.
    • i.e. if it would get a copystrike on YouTube it is not acceptable


  • These are for minimum 70%...Make it better for a better grade.

Feeling Stuck? Things to Try:

  • Use costumes to help bring your animations to life!
  • Make your sprite interactive by adding scripts that have the sprite respond to clicks, key presses, and more.
  • Add instructions on the project page to explain how people can interact with your program.
